MySQL8.0.23免安裝版配置詳細教程

第一步 下載免安裝版Mysql 8.0.23 版本

點擊下載MySQL8.0.23壓縮包

解壓文件,進入\mysql-8.0.23-winx64 文件夾中 解壓完全後的目錄

在這裡插入圖片描述

第二步 創建txt文件改名為my.ini (後綴修改為ini)

在這裡插入圖片描述

第三步 打開my.ini將以下內容復制進入my.ini

[mysql]
#設置mysql客戶端默認字符集
default-character-set=utf8
[mysqld]
#設置3306端口
port =3306
#設置安裝目錄
basedir=D:\soft\java\07mysql-8.0.22-winx64
#設置數據存放目錄
datadir=D:\soft\java\07mysql-8.0.22-winx64\data
#允許最大連接數
max_connections=200
#創建新表時將使用帶默認存貯引擎
default-storage-engine=INNODB

註意:

#設置安裝目錄
basedir=D:\soft\java\07mysql-8.0.22-winx64
#設置數據存放目錄
datadir=D:\soft\java\07mysql-8.0.22-winx64\data

安裝目錄一定要根據自己的文件路徑修改 data文件可以不用手動創建但是路徑中要寫

第四步 以管理員身份打開cmd

開始菜單 搜索cmd 用快捷鍵打開:Ctrl + Shift + Enter

在這裡插入圖片描述

進入所在文件的bin目錄下

在這裡插入圖片描述

第五步 初始化mysql

在MySQL安裝目錄的 bin 目錄下執行命令:

mysqld --initialize --console

命令執行後

mysqld --install [服務名]
註釋 mysqld --remove [服務名] 為刪除服務 (不需要執行 隻是作為擴展)

[Note] [MY-010454] [Server] A temporary password is generated for root@localhost: APWCY5ws&hjQ

localhost: 後面APWCY5ws&hjQ則為初始密碼

第六步 安裝與運行服務 安裝服務

在MySQL安裝目錄的 bin 目錄下執行命令:

net start mysql
註釋 net stop mysql 為停止服務 (不需要執行 隻是作為擴展)

服務名隨意 個人建議根據數據庫版本來 比如 mysql8

啟動服務

net start mysql
註釋 net stop mysql 為停止服務 (不需要執行 隻是作為擴展)

第七步 更改密碼和密碼認證插件

mysql -u root -p

在這裡插入圖片描述

輸入初始密碼APWCY5ws&hjQ

在這裡插入圖片描述

成功進入Mysql

第八步 修改初始密碼

ALTER USER ‘root'@‘localhost' IDENTIFIED WITH mysql_native_password BY ‘password';

執行sql語句最後的password就是你要修改的密碼

最後的擴展

刷新權限
mysql: FLUSH PRIVILEGES;
數據庫授權
mysql: GRANT ALL PRIVILEGES ON . TO ‘root'@'%' IDENTIFIED BY ‘123456' WITH GRANT OPTION;

到此這篇關於MySQL8.0.23免安裝版配置教程(詳解)的文章就介紹到這瞭,更多相關MySQL8.0.23免安裝版配置內容請搜索WalkonNet以前的文章或繼續瀏覽下面的相關文章希望大傢以後多多支持WalkonNet!

推薦閱讀: